Understand USB C and Its Advantages

USB C, also known as USB Type – C, is a reversible connector that has become increasingly popular in recent years. It offers several advantages over traditional USB connectors:

  • Faster Charging: USB C chargers can support higher power delivery, allowing for faster charging times. For example, some USB C chargers can deliver up to 100W of power, which can quickly charge a laptop or multiple devices simultaneously.
  • High – Speed Data Transfer: USB C ports support data transfer speeds of up to 10Gbps or even 40Gbps in some cases. This makes it ideal for transferring large files, such as videos or backups, in a short amount of time.
  • Versatility: USB C can be used for charging, data transfer, and even video output. You can connect your laptop to an external monitor or TV using a USB C to HDMI adapter, for instance.

 

Consider Your Device’s Power Requirements

The first step in choosing the best USB C charger is to understand your device’s power requirements. Different devices have different power needs, and using a charger with the wrong power output can lead to slow charging or even damage to your device. Below is a quick reference table for common device types:

Device Type
Typical Power Requirement
Example Devices
Smartphones
18W – 120W
iPhone 15 (45W), Samsung S24 (45W), OnePlus 12 (100W)
Tablets
10W – 65W
iPad Pro (30W), Samsung Tab S9 (45W), Lenovo Tab P12 (65W)
Laptops
65W – 140W
MacBook Air (65W), Dell XPS 13 (65W), ASUS ROG Zephyrus (140W)

 

Look for the Right Charging Protocol

Charging protocols are the languages that chargers and devices use to communicate with each other. To ensure fast and efficient charging, your charger and device need to support the same charging protocol. Use the table below to match protocols with your devices:

Charging Protocol
Main Features
Compatible Devices
USB Power Delivery (PD)
Dynamic power adjustment, wide compatibility
iPhones, iPads, MacBooks, most Android phones/laptops
Quick Charge (QC)
Developed by Qualcomm, fast charging for Android
Android devices with Qualcomm processors (e.g., Samsung Galaxy S series, Google Pixel)
Proprietary Protocols
Brand – specific, maximum speed for own devices
Samsung Super Fast Charge (Galaxy), Huawei SuperCharge (Mate/P series), Oppo VOOC (Find X series)

 

Evaluate the Number of Ports

If you have multiple USB C – enabled devices, you may want to consider a charger with multiple ports. This allows you to charge multiple devices simultaneously, saving you time and hassle.

  • Single – Port Chargers: Single – port chargers are the simplest and most compact option. They are ideal if you only need to charge one device at a time. However, if you have multiple devices, you may need to carry multiple chargers, which can be inconvenient.
  • Multi – Port Chargers: Multi – port chargers typically come with 2 – 4 ports, allowing you to charge multiple devices simultaneously. Some multi – port chargers can intelligently distribute power among the ports, ensuring that each device gets the right amount of power for fast charging. For example, a 65W multi – port charger may be able to deliver 45W to a laptop and 20W to a smartphone when both are connected.

 

Check for Safety Features

Safety should always be a top priority when choosing a USB C charger. Look for chargers that have built – in safety features to protect your devices from overcharging, overheating, and short – circuits.

  • Over – Voltage Protection: This feature prevents the charger from delivering too much voltage to the device, which can damage the battery or other components.
  • Over – Current Protection: Over – current protection ensures that the charger does not deliver too much current to the device, which can also cause damage.
  • Short – Circuit Protection: In the event of a short – circuit, the charger will automatically cut off the power to prevent damage to the device and the charger itself.
  • Thermal Protection: Chargers can get hot during use, especially when charging high – power devices. Thermal protection ensures that the charger shuts down or reduces power output if it gets too hot, preventing overheating and potential fire hazards.

 

Consider the Build Quality and Portability

The build quality of the charger is also an important factor to consider. A well – built charger is more likely to be durable and last longer. Look for chargers that are made of high – quality materials and have a solid construction.
  • Portability: If you are often on the go, portability is crucial. Look for chargers that are compact and lightweight, making them easy to carry in your bag or pocket. Some chargers even come with foldable plugs, which further reduces their size and makes them more convenient to carry.
